יום רביעי, 28 בספטמבר 2016

שפת C - ספריית המתמטיקה, טבלת אסקי קוד, char והאופרטורים : ? (יום רביעי)

למדנו היום:


פונקצית הספריה <math.h>

pow 
מקבלת מספרים ומחזירה את התוצאה של הראשון בחזקת השני
#include <stdio.h>
#include <math.h>
void main()
{
double a,b,t;
 
scanf ("%lf%lf",&a,&b);
t = pow(a,b);
t = pow(a+2,b);
}

בגלל שהחזקה יכולה גם להיות מינוס, שפת C מגדירה את הערך של הפונקציה תמיד כמספר ממשי.


sqrt
מקבלת מספר ומחזירה את השורש הריבועי שלו

יום שלישי, 27 בספטמבר 2016

יום שני, 26 בספטמבר 2016

שיעור SQL (יום שני)

למדנו:



שיעורי אינטרנט:

לכתוב בעזרת גוגל על הנושאים הבאים:

אילוצים בשפת (DML (Data Manipulation Language :

PK מפתח ראשי
FK מפתח זר

יום שישי, 23 בספטמבר 2016

אפליקציה לכתיבה בשפת C מהטלפון!

כמו שהכותרת אומרת...





Barkai_In_Blood_and_Soul

שיעור שפת סף - ארכיטקטורה ופקודות בשפת אסמבלי 86 (יום חמישי)

למדנו:
ארכיטקטורה של מעבד 8086:
במעבד יש 14 "אוגרים" מ5 סוגים:

4 "אוגרים כלליים" ( AX, BX, CX, DX) (לפעמים BX יכול לשמש כאוגר מצביע)
4 אוגרי מצביע (SI, DI, BP, SP)
4 אוגרי מקטע (DS, CS, SS, ES)
1 אוגר דגלים
1 אוגר מצביע הוראה IP


לעוד מידע:




פקודות בשפת אסמבלי 86:


MOV  (מעתיק)
XCHG  (החלפה)

יום רביעי, 21 בספטמבר 2016

שפת C - למדנו switch case (יום רביעי)

הסברים בשיעור:



חזרה:

///////////////////////// Exe num 4 #include <stdio.h> void main() { int num; printf("Enter number: "); scanf("%d",&num); if(num%3 == 0) printf("%d\n",num); else  if((num+1)%3 == 0)  printf("%d\n",num+1); else printf("%d\n",num-1); }

שיעור SQL (יום שלישי)



מושגים שצריך לכתוב עליהם:
Client Server
PK
Column
DDL
DML






יום רביעי, 24 באוגוסט 2016

פתיחה!

כל ה"סטודנטים" בברקאי שנה שנייה מוזמנים ליהנות מהבלוג החדש!

בבלוג תוכלו למצוא מידע, תמיכה, קישורים מומלצים ופוסטים
יומיים בנוגע לכל הקורסים הנילמדים השנה!

בהמשך יהיו גם סקרים דיונים המלצות ועוד...

יום רביעי, 17 באוגוסט 2016

התקנת ויזואל סטודיו


הורדת והתקנת Visual Studio



ויז'ואל סטודיו (Visual Studio) היא סביבת פיתוח מובילה מבית חברת מיקרוסופט, המאפשרת למתכנתים לפתח תוכניות מחשב, אתרי אינטרנט ועוד. איתה נכתוב את רוב הקוד שלנו במהלך הלימודים.

מומלץ תמיד להשתמש בגרסה האחרונה של Visual Studio. (שהיא אגב, חינמית). הגרסה האחרונה נכון לשנת 2019 היא: VS2019. אני מאמין שתצליחו למצוא ולהוריד אותה בקלות. לבד.






קישורים נוספים:
מדריך ישן להתקנת Visual Studio 2012



Visual Studio 2012 PRO

[נכתב וצולם על ידי: אליאב בוסקילה]

המדריך הבא הוא מדריך ישן להתקנת Visual Studio 2012 PRO.
(לחצו על התמונות להגדלה)



הורדת והתקנת  Visual Studio 2012

1. קובץ התקנה:  הורידו את הקובץ.
2. אחרי הורדת 2 הקבצים (קובץ התקנה וקובץ טקסט), פיתחו את הקובץ התקנה.



יום רביעי, 13 באפריל 2016

כללים פשוטים לקניית מחשב


מה מתכנת צריך לחפש במחשב





מחשב לא חייב הרבה, אבל יש דברים עיקריים שלא כדאי למתכנת להתפשר עליהם:

- שידלק מהר לאחר מצב שינה/כיבוי.
- שיהיה נוח לשימוש ארוך זמן.
- ששטח האיחסון יהיה גדול מספיק.
- שיצליח להריץ תוכנות עריכת קוד במהירות ובמקביל מבלי להיתקע.
- שיהיה בעל מספר נוח של חיבורים חיצוניים.

[כמובן שלמחשב יכולות להיות עוד הרבה תכונות חיוביות: גודל מסך, סוללה, משקל, רמקולים ועוד...
נסו להתמקד קודם כל בתכונות החשובות ביותר עבורכם, המתכנתים.]






נרד לפרטים הקטנים:
- רזולוציית מסך של 720p או 1080p. לא פחות ולא יותר! (רזולוציית 4K עדיין לא נתמכת בתוכנות רבות).
- זיכרון RAM של 8GB או 16GB.
- מעבד i7, או i5 שמהשנים האחרונות.
-  שטח אחסון של 256GB או יותר.
- עבור מהירות ההדלקה, מומלץ מאוד שלפחות מערכת ההפעלה תרוץ על כונן SSD.
- אין צורך בקורא דיסקים.
- לפחות שלוש כניסות USB.
- חיבור לכבל רשת.
- מערכת הפעלה: Windows 7/Windows 10.
- מומלץ מסך בגודל 15.6 או יותר. בפרט אם זה המחשב העיקרי שלכם.
- מניסיון שלי ושל חבריי אני לא ממליץ לקנות מחשבים של החברה Dell, ואני ממליץ במיוחד על Asus. כמובן יש שיחלקו.







כמה אמור לעלות המחשב?
מחשב פשוט אמור לעלות בין 2500₪-3600₪.
אם רוצים להשקיע אפשר להגיע גם ל-5500₪, אך יותר מזה כבר לא מומלץ להשקיע מהסיבה הפשוטה שכל שנה ערך המחשבים של השנה שלפניה יורד מאוד.
אם חסר לכם מקום אחסון תוכלו לרכוש כונן קשיח חיצוני.





קניה מהנה!